1. What is the Return on Investment (ROI) and Long-Term Cost-Effectiveness?

For municipalities, the financial viability of any infrastructure project is crucial. While the initial investment in custom smart solar street lighting might be higher than traditional grid-tied systems, the long-term savings are substantial. Solar street lights eliminate electricity bills entirely, representing a 100% saving on energy consumption. Considering that the average daily solar radiation in Dubai is exceptionally high, typically ranging from 5 to 6 kWh/m²/day, these systems harness ample energy efficiently.

Furthermore, maintenance costs are significantly reduced. Modern LED light sources have a lifespan of 50,000 to 100,000 hours, and advanced LiFePO4 batteries offer 2,000 to 4,000 charge cycles, equating to 10+ years of reliable operation. Solar panels themselves often come with a 25-year performance warranty. These factors contribute to a typical ROI period of 3-5 years, after which municipalities enjoy virtually free illumination and substantial operational expenditure (OpEx) savings for decades. This aligns perfectly with Dubai's strategic push for energy efficiency and sustainability targets outlined by entities like DEWA.

2. How Do These Systems Perform and Ensure Reliability in Dubai's Harsh Climate?

Dubai's climate presents unique challenges: intense heat, high humidity, dust, and occasional sandstorms. Custom smart solar street lighting systems designed for this environment must be incredibly robust.

  • Heat Resistance: High-quality solar panels maintain efficiency even at elevated temperatures, and modern LiFePO4 batteries are chosen for their superior thermal stability, operating effectively in ambient temperatures up to 60-70°C, outperforming traditional battery types.
  • Dust and Sand: Components are built with high Ingress Protection (IP) ratings (e.g., IP65 or IP66) to prevent dust and water intrusion. Smooth surfaces and potentially anti-dust coatings on solar panels minimize accumulation, though periodic cleaning is still recommended (e.g., quarterly or bi-annually, depending on dust levels).
  • Structural Integrity: Poles and fixtures are engineered to withstand strong winds and sand erosion, often using marine-grade aluminum or galvanized steel with protective coatings.
  • Autonomy: Systems are typically designed with 3-5 days of battery autonomy to ensure continuous lighting even during extended periods of cloudy weather or heavy dust accumulation on panels.

3. What 'Smart' Functionalities Are Available, and How Do They Integrate with Dubai's Smart City Vision?

The 'smart' aspect is where these systems truly shine, aligning with Dubai's ambitious smart city initiatives. Modern solar street lights can be equipped with:

  • Remote Monitoring and Control (IoT): Utilizing technologies like LoRaWAN, NB-IoT, or 4G, municipalities can monitor performance, battery status, and energy generation in real-time from a central management system (CMS). This allows for proactive maintenance and optimized energy use.
  • Adaptive Lighting: Integrated PIR motion sensors or radar sensors allow lights to dim when no activity is detected and brighten upon approach, saving energy and reducing light pollution while enhancing safety.
  • Scheduled Dimming: Programmed lighting schedules can adjust brightness levels throughout the night, for example, dimming to 50% during off-peak hours (e.g., 1 AM to 5 AM) to further conserve energy.
  • Fault Detection: The system can automatically report issues like LED failures or battery anomalies, enabling rapid response and minimal downtime.
  • Environmental Sensors: Some advanced systems can integrate sensors for air quality, temperature, and humidity, contributing valuable data to the broader smart city ecosystem.

These functionalities support Dubai's vision for intelligent infrastructure, enhancing urban living, optimizing resource management, and contributing to data-driven decision-making.

4. Can These Systems Be Customized to Meet Specific Municipal Aesthetic, Lighting, and Infrastructure Requirements?

Yes, 'custom' is a key aspect of these solutions. Municipalities often have specific requirements for pole heights, luminaire designs, light distribution patterns, and even color temperatures to match urban aesthetics or specific safety standards. Customization options include:

  • Pole Design: Varying heights (e.g., 6m to 12m), materials, and aesthetic styles (e.g., decorative, modern, classic) to blend with the urban landscape.
  • Lumen Output and Distribution: Tailored LED power (e.g., 30W to 120W equivalent) and precise light distribution optics (Type II, Type III, Type IV) to ensure optimal illumination for roads, pathways, or public squares without light spill.
  • Color Temperature: Choice of warm white (3000K), neutral white (4000K), or cool white (5000K-6000K) to create the desired ambiance and visibility.
  • System Integration: Ensuring compatibility with existing smart city communication protocols or future expansion plans.
  • Battery Backup: Custom autonomy days (e.g., 3, 4, or 5 nights) based on project risk assessment and local climate patterns.

This flexibility ensures that the lighting solutions are not just functional but also enhance the architectural and environmental integrity of Dubai's public spaces.

5. What are the Maintenance Demands and Expected Lifespan of These Systems?

One of the most attractive features of solar street lighting is its low maintenance requirement, especially compared to traditional grid-tied systems. Key aspects include:

  • Panel Cleaning: The primary maintenance task involves cleaning solar panels to remove dust and dirt, which can reduce efficiency. In dusty environments like Dubai, this might be required quarterly or bi-annually.
  • Component Longevity: As mentioned, high-quality LEDs last 50,000-100,000 hours, LiFePO4 batteries last 10+ years, and solar panels typically 25+ years. The smart controllers and other electronics are also designed for long-term outdoor operation.
  • Remote Diagnostics: Smart monitoring systems significantly reduce the need for physical inspections, as potential issues can often be identified remotely, allowing for targeted maintenance visits.
  • Reduced Labor: No trenching for wiring, no electricity bills, and fewer component replacements mean a substantial reduction in labor costs associated with traditional street lighting maintenance.

With proper installation and minimal routine care, custom smart solar street lighting systems offer a reliable and long-lasting illumination solution for Dubai's municipalities.
